Portable Terahertz remote sensing detector and remote detection method

The invention discloses a portable Terahertz remote sensing detector and a remote detection method. The detector comprises a signal generating device, a detector, a processor and an imaging display device, wherein the signal generating device comprises a Terahertz wave radiation source, a broadband tunable laser and a plasma generator; and the detector comprises a receiving element, a detecting element and a signal modulation circuit. The detection method comprises the following steps of: 1, dividing scanning subregions and pixel points and encoding scanning output frequencies of various scanning subregions; 2, arranging an assembly and generating a remote detection signal; 3, performing two-dimensional scanning; and 4, performing signal analysis processing, namely rapidly imaging and generating a Terahertz wave image with frequency spectrum characteristics, identifying a material type of a tested object, generating a charge coupled device (CCD) image and identifying the shape of the tested object. The detector is reasonable in design, easy to operate, flexible in detection mode, wide in application range and good in detection effect, and can fulfill the aims of rapidly imaging and remotely detecting by combining THz and induced fluorescence spectrum analysis with space imaging.

Full-automatic liquid adding device for fracturing construction and adding calibration method

The invention belongs to the technical field of fracturing construction mechanization, and particularly provides a full-automatic liquid adding device for fracturing construction and an adding calibration method. The full-automatic liquid adding device comprises a prying frame, an engine, a transfer case, a hydraulic device, a liquid adding pump, a metering calibration tank, a liquid additive tank, a liquid supply pump and a control unit, wherein the input ends of the engine, the transfer case and the hydraulic device are sequentially connected; the output end of the hydraulic device is connected with the liquid supply pump and the liquid adding pump; the liquid supply pump is connected with an inlet of the liquid additive tank; an outlet of the liquid additive tank is sequentially connected with inlets of the metering calibration tank, the liquid adding pump and the liquid additive tank; the control unit is electrically connected with the engine, the transfer case, the hydraulic device, the liquid adding pump, the metering calibration tank, the liquid supply pump and the liquid additive tank; and the current situation that in the fracturing construction process, the liquid additive adding precision is large in adding difficulty and discontinuous is avoided, the mechanization and automation degree of fracturing construction is improved, meanwhile, the construction quality and potential safety hazards are effectively eliminated, and the construction success rate is increased.

Dynamic real-time monitoring method for concrete bridge prestressed tendon tensioning force and special prestress construction system

The invention belongs to bridge construction, and particularly relates to dynamic real-time monitoring method for concrete bridge prestressed tendon tensioning force and a special prestress construction system. The dynamic real-time monitoring method for the concrete bridge prestressed tendon tensioning force includes the steps of initializing and real-time dynamic control loading. The prestress construction system comprises at least one tensioning device, and each tensioning device comprises a hydraulic station, a reversing valve bank, a jack, an A/D data collecting module, a PLC, a central processing unit, a human-computer interface, a direct force measuring device, a hydraulic force measuring device, a prestressed tendon elongation measuring device, a friction resistance test device and a security alarm device. The double-control requirement, difficult to met in the prior art, for taking stress control as the principle thing and an elongation value as a checking item is met, the dynamic real-time monitoring method has the advantages that construction quality and safety can be effectively ensured, and problems found in the tensioning process can be solved in time.

Installing cabinet for communication system information switch

The invention discloses a communication system information exchange installation cabinet, which comprises a base, a cabinet installed on the top of the base and an integrally formed roof on the top of the cabinet. Two heat dissipation windows are opened on both sides of the cabinet, and the two heat dissipation windows are located On both sides of the cabinet close to the top and bottom, a through hole is opened in the middle of the top plate, and a top cover is installed on the top of the top plate, and the bottom of both sides of the top cover is provided with air suction ports. The outside of the air suction port and the inside of the heat dissipation window Both are equipped with dust-proof nets, and fans are installed on the top of the top cover corresponding to the through holes on the top plate. In the present invention, a fan and a fan controller are installed in the top cover on the top of the top plate, and temperature sensors are arranged on both sides of the through hole on the top plate corresponding to the position of the fan, and the heat dissipation windows are set on both sides of the cabinet body, so that the cabinet itself has automatic The active heat dissipation effect effectively replaces the traditional natural heat dissipation and improves the heat dissipation efficiency of the cabinet.

Nested type three-phase mixing nozzle of water, oil and gas and nozzle system with same

The invention provides a nested type three-phase mixing nozzle of water, oil and gas. The nested type three-phase mixing nozzle comprises a nozzle body, a nesting ring and a mixing chamber, and is characterized in that the nozzle body comprises a head portion, a middle portion and a bottom, the head portion of the nozzle body is a cone, and a spray hole is formed in the top end of the head portion of the nozzle body; the middle portion of the nozzle body is a cylinder, and at least two gas holes are evenly formed in the cylinder; the bottom of the nozzle body is of a thread structure; the nesting ring and the middle portion of the nozzle body are matched to form a clearance structure; an inner chamber with the top of a cone is arranged inside the nozzle body; the mixing chamber is arranged in the inner chamber and corresponds to the position of the middle portion of the nozzle body; a fluid channel communicated with the spray hole is further formed in the top of the inner chamber. The nozzle is arranged in a metal processing lubricating device, point lubricating is achieved, the problem that gas consumption is large in existing novel metal near-dry type processing lubricating is solved, meanwhile, a power source is saved, and the advantages of saving lubricating oil and being more environmentally friendly are achieved.
